Arunachal CM, Dy CM condole Buddhadeb Bhattacharjee’s demise

Date:

Arunachal Pradesh Chief Minister Pema Khandu condoled the demise of former West Bengal Chief Minister and veteran communist leader Buddhadeb Bhattacharjee, who passed away on Thursday at his residence in Kolkata.

“I am saddened by the demise of the former Chief Minister of West Bengal, Shri Buddhadeb Bhattacharjee. His vast tenure of over five decades as an MLA, Minister, and eventually Chief Minister has left a lasting legacy. Renowned for his humility, significant contributions to Bengali literature, and unwavering dedication to public service, he will be deeply missed. My sincere condolences go out to his family and followers. Om Shanti,” Khandu posted on X.

Arunachal Pradesh Deputy Chief Minister Chowna Mein said he is “deeply saddened” by the passing of the former West Bengal CM and extended heartfelt condolences to his family and well wishers.

Mein also said the late Bhattacharjee’s humility and dedication to public service are commendable and will be remembered.
